While the Bram Stoker issue has been postponed, there will still be a fantastic new issue of Dracula Beyond Stoker available in November. Full info on that will be coming soon, but we’re excited to tell you that one of the contributors - writer/actor/magician Patrick Terry - will be performing “Houdini Speaks to the Living” this month (Aug 7-15, 17-22) at the Edinburgh Fringe Festival!

“The year is 1924. Harry Houdini is at the peak of his fame, touring the country with performance-lectures that expose fraudulent mediums and challenge the growing Spiritualist movement. At the same moment, his friend (and eventual adversary) Sir Arthur Conan Doyle is lecturing in passionate defense of Spiritualism, convinced it represents a profound philosophical and moral evolution for humanity. Watch these two legends battle out the true nature of magic, science and faith through a historically based, largely verbatim play from writer-director Beth Burns and writer-magician Patrick Terry.”

Regular DBS contributor Brian Forrest has recently edited a new edition of The Black Vampyre. He examines all of the “firsts” that the story achieved - first American vampire, first black vampire, first staking, and many more - with his usual Toothpickings humor.

Whether or not you’ve read the story before, this edition is well worth picking up.

You can also hear Brian talk about it on the latest episode of The Ghostly Gallery podcast.
